Gallup: Mitt Romney Soars
Back To 5-Point Lead Over Obama

Business Insider, by Brett LoGiurato

Original Article

Posted By:BuckeyeRon, 10/26/2012 2:13:00 PM

Republican nominee Mitt Romney jumped back out to a 5-point lead over President Barack Obama in Gallup's daily tracking poll of likely voters Friday, and now leads the president 51-46. Obama and Romney are now tied, 48-48, among registered voters, and the president's approval rating dipped to just 48 percent, below the "safe" level for an incumbent's re-election. The results indicate the halting of what had been a pronounced Obama bounce over the past seven days of polling. Obama had climbed back from a 7-point deficit a week ago to just 3 points over the past two days.

Feds arrest suspect in ricin-positive
letters sent to Obama, senator
NBC News, by Pete Williams*    Original Article
Posted By: BuckeyeRon- 4/17/2013 7:51:06 PM     Post Reply
Federal agents on Wednesday arrested a suspect in the mailing of letters to President Barack Obama and a U.S. senator that initially tested positive for the poison ricin. The suspect was identified as Kenneth Curtis of Tupelo, Miss., federal officials told NBC News. Both letters carried an identical closing statement, according to an FBI bulletin obtained by NBC News on Wednesday. According to the FBI bulletin, both letters, postmarked April 8, 2013 out of Memphis, Tenn., included an identical phrase, "to see a wrong and not expose it, is to become a silent partner to its continuance."

Senate rejects background checks
on gun purchases in 54-46 vote
Hill [Washington,DC], by Alexander Bolton    Original Article
Posted By: BuckeyeRon- 4/17/2013 4:41:19 PM     Post Reply
The Senate delivered a devastating blow to President Obama’s agenda to regulate guns Wednesday by defeating a bipartisan proposal to expand background checks. It failed by a vote of 54 to 46, with 5 Democrats voting against it. Only 4 Republicans supported it. Democratic Sens. Mark Pryor (Ark.), Max Baucus (Mont.), Heidi Heitkamp (N.D.), Mark Begich (Alaska) and Senate Majority Leader Harry Reid (Nev.) voted against it.
